Phytoplankton are algae that grow where there is sufficient light to support photosynthesis. The specification of a physical process by the phrase \"due_to_\" process means that the quantity named is a single term in a sum of terms which together compose the general quantity named by omitting the phrase. \"Irradiance\" means the power per unit area (called radiative flux in other standard names), the area being normal to the direction of flow of the radiant energy.
